What is Vacate Cleaning?

End of lease cleaning, also referred to as exit cleaning, is a thorough cleaning of the property before returning it to the real estate agent. Unlike basic maintenance, this involves deep cleaning of every nook and cranny of the house to ensure it meets the rental requirements.

Areas Covered in End of Lease Cleaning

• Common Areas & Sleeping Spaces: Wiping down furniture, removing dust, washing window panes, and removing cobwebs.
• Pantry: Degreasing stovetops, cleaning ovens, wiping countertops, and scrubbing sinks.
• Bathroom & Toilets: Scrubbing tiles, disinfecting sinks, cleaning toilets, and washing shower screens.
• Flooring & Walls: Wiping down walls, scrubbing flooring, and shampooing rugs if required.
• Window Frames & Handles: Polishing glass panels, end of lease cleaning in Melbourne wiping down door handles, and removing smudges.

DIY End of Lease Cleaning Tips

If you prefer to clean the property yourself, follow these practical tips:
• Use strong cleaning products to get a deeper clean.
• Start cleaning from top to bottom to ensure efficiency.
• Pay close detail to bathrooms, as these spaces are scrutinized.
• Consider renting a steam cleaner for carpets if required by your lease agreement.
